Team Deis Books Ticket Into SaskTel Tankard

The Ryan Deis rink out of the Fox Valley Curling Club went undefeated en route to claiming the Saskatchewan Men’s Curling Tour spiel this past weekend at the Regina Highland Curling Club. Team Deis defended their title in fashion as they were last years champions at this very same event.

With the win, Team Deis has now received a direct berth into the 2018 SaskTel Tankard Men’s Provincial Championship, which will take place January 31 – February 4 at Affinity Place in Estevan.

The next SCT Bonspiel will take place down in Estevan Dec. 1-3, where there will be another direct berth into provincials up for grabs!

Regina Callie Hosts Junior Men’s & Women’s Q-Spiel #1

There were no short of curlers and curling fans around the Regina Callie Curling Club over this long weekend, as 21 Junior Men’s & 18 Junior Women’s teams went head to head looking to claim one of eight available berths into the Jiffy Lube Junior Provincial Curling Championship Dec. 27-31, 2017.

The Junior Men’s & Women’s fields featured past U18 & Junior Champions looking to regain those green and white jackets and represent Saskatchewan at this years New Holland Canadian Junior Curling Championship, but also young and upcoming teams looking to gain crucial Winter Games Points into the selection process towards the 2019 Canada Winter Games.

 

Below are the teams who punched their ticket into the Jiffy Lube Provincial Championship back at the Regina Callie late December:

Junior Men’s:

Team Jayden Bindig – Wadena
Team Rylan Kleiter – Saskatoon
Team Travis Tokarz – Saskatoon
Team Mitchell Dales – Regina

Junior Women’s:

Team Tegan Zankl – Regina
Team Chaelynn Kitz – Saskatoon
Team Sara England – Regina
Team Hanna Anderson – Saskatoon

Congratulations to all teams who qualified, and good luck to the remaining teams as Q-Spiels #2 get underway next weekend, Nov. 24-26, in Watrous (Men’s) & Wadena (Women’s).
